Santa Clara’s Vice Mayor Dominic Caserta didn’t mince words when he lamented about this week’s curfew-busting concert by U2 at Levi’s Stadium. “What happened last night,” he said, “was sad and inappropriate.”. Sad that the world-famous band, event organizers and San Francisco 49ers which operate the stadium did nothing to stop the music at the 10 p.m. cutoff. Sad that the noise continued for another hour, upsetting neighbors. And very sad that the city and the Niners find themselves once again at loggerheads over a late-night high-decibel dust-up, perched at the precipice of ugly legal action between the two parties.

Levi’s is no stranger to curfew-breakers — Beyonce went beyond her allotted time during a show last year. Then there’s the annual Bridge School Benefit at the Shoreline, which according to one Bay Area music critic is known for having its music spill over into the post-curfew hours. And every other major outdoor venue in the region, especially those located in or near residential areas, like the Greek Theater in Berkeley or the Montalvo Art Center in Saratoga, has had to deal with curfews, how to enforce them and what to do when they’re violated. BottleRock apparently takes its 10 p.m. curfew quite seriously. In 2014, as The Cure cranked up their 34th song of the evening (“Why Can’t I Be You?”), the band suddenly found its power had been cut by the festival crew, which was apparently anxious about its tenuous relationship with the city of Napa. According to the Setlist.fm, which calls itself The Setlist Wiki, the shutdown went down like this: “(Plug pulled. Sound started to fade…mic first completely, then instruments)”.

But suddenly, it all came to a crashing halt. As my colleague Sal Pizarro wrote at the time, “Was the P-Funk too much for the festival? That’s what some fans where wondering after the power went out at the end of Friday night’s headline show at Plaza de Cesar Chavez. Did the festival pull the plug because the party was getting too loud and going on too long?”. Nope. This was a case of mistaken identity: The cutoff may have looked like a nearly-broken curfew. But it was actually a tripped circuit breaker. Parliament-Funkadelic returns to San Jose Jazz this year for the first time since; let’s hope they’ve bulked up the grid.
